Halftime, authored by Bob Buford, explores the concept of individuals transitioning from the first half of their lives, often focused on success and achievement as traditionally defined, to a second half dedicated to significance and purpose. The central idea is to leverage the skills, resources, and wisdom gained in the initial phase of life to make a meaningful contribution to the world in the latter half. For example, a successful business executive might use their experience to mentor young entrepreneurs or contribute to philanthropic endeavors.

Published in 1991, this work resonated with many individuals approaching or in midlife, seeking greater fulfillment. It encourages readers to reflect on their values, passions, and potential legacy. By prompting introspection and providing a framework for action, it empowers individuals to shift their focus from personal gain to serving a larger purpose. This concept has had a significant impact on discussions surrounding life planning, career transitions, and the pursuit of a meaningful life, particularly within faith-based communities.

Automated verification of interactions between separate software components, as documented in Marie Drake’s publication, ensures that services communicate correctly and adhere to established agreements. For instance, a shopping cart service might have a contract with a payment gateway service. Verification involves confirming the expected requests and responses between these two services, ensuring smooth transaction processing.

This approach to software development improves reliability, reduces integration issues, and supports independent development and deployment of microservices. By defining clear expectations early in the development lifecycle, the approach fosters better collaboration between teams and minimizes costly rework later on. Historically, integration testing often occurred late in the process, leading to delays and unexpected failures. The documented methodology provides a proactive approach to integration, facilitating faster release cycles and more robust software systems.

Book folding is a papercraft art form that transforms a book into a sculpted, three-dimensional piece by folding individual pages. Complimentary folding instructions, readily available online and from other sources, specify precise measurements and folding angles for each page, ultimately producing intricate designs ranging from simple geometric shapes to complex representational forms like animals or objects. These instructions are often provided as downloadable PDFs or printable templates.

This accessible art form offers a creative outlet with minimal material requirements beyond a book and the instructions themselves. It presents an opportunity to repurpose old or unwanted books, giving them new life as decorative items. The historical context of book folding is relatively recent, gaining significant popularity with the rise of internet communities and online resource sharing. This accessibility and the potential for personalized artistic expression contribute to the craft’s ongoing popularity.

Children’s literature featuring a bovine leaping over Earth’s satellite is a common motif, often originating from the nursery rhyme “Hey Diddle Diddle.” These narratives frequently incorporate fantastical elements and simple, rhyming text, making them accessible and engaging for young audiences. Picture books with this theme typically depict vibrant illustrations of the titular action, often alongside other whimsical characters and scenarios from the rhyme, such as the dish running away with the spoon.

Such books serve as an early introduction to literature and language for toddlers and preschoolers. The rhythmic nature of the source material assists in developing phonemic awareness and can contribute to vocabulary growth. Visually, these books stimulate imagination and creativity, fostering a love for reading and storytelling from a young age. Furthermore, they introduce children to fundamental concepts like animals, celestial bodies, and the playful use of absurdity in narrative. These stories hold a cherished place in early childhood education and have been enjoyed across generations, contributing to a shared cultural experience.
